Output e3ddca082d5d358c6fcaa5ea9d38265f6d7c44311fb7fc090b84feea0d2698dd:0

value
148948262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dfa9260152b30356323b114f0b22ee688075744 OP_EQUAL
address
37LjKH4noXSUMGxUZ5TTXbEesNtW2yyqFd
transaction
e3ddca082d5d358c6fcaa5ea9d38265f6d7c44311fb7fc090b84feea0d2698dd
confirmations
385391
spent
true